2. Technical Architecture & Legal Framework of Bonded Storage in Austria
Operating a bonded supply chain within Austria requires deep compliance expertise with the European Union Customs Code (Regulation EU No 952/2013 - UCC) and national implementation governed by the Austrian Customs Administration (Zollamt Österreich). A clear operational understanding of customs regimes is vital for supply chain directors to eliminate operational bottlenecks.
Key Regulatory Pillars under the EU Union Customs Code (UCC)
- Duty Suspension Regime (Zollaussetzung): Goods entering an authorized Austrian bonded warehouse remain in non-Union status. Tarrying under customs supervision suspends Customs Duty (Zoll) and Import VAT (EUSt) indefinitely or until release into free circulation (Überführung in den zollrechtlich freien Verkehr).
- Fiscal Representation (Fiskalvertretung § 26a UStG): Non-resident manufacturers importing goods into Austria can utilize Fiscal Representation. This allows the import VAT to be declared and neutralized simultaneously through the importer's Austrian tax ID, drastically reducing working capital requirements.
- T1 External Community Transit Procedure: Cargo landed at European maritime entry ports (e.g., Port of Koper, Slovenia or Port of Hamburg, Germany) moves under NCTS T1 transit bond directly to the inland Austrian bonded facility without paying duties at the port of arrival.
- Inward Processing Relief (IPR / Aktive Veredelung): Austrian high-precision manufacturers importing raw materials or component sub-assemblies can process, assemble, or repair products within a bonded status, exempting inputs from import tariffs if the finished goods are re-exported outside the EU.

Optimization Case: Adriatic Port Corridor vs. Northern Gateway Route
For manufacturers sourcing from China, Southeast Asia, or the US Gulf Coast and shipping to Austria, route optimization is crucial for reducing transit time and carbon footprint:
- The Adriatic Route (Port of Koper / Trieste → Austrian Bonded Hubs): Maritime transit from Asian ports via the Suez Canal directly to Koper (Slovenia) saves 5 to 7 days of sea transit compared to Northern ports. From Koper, direct block trains haul bonded T1 containers to Graz or Vienna terminals in under 24 hours.
- The Northern Range Route (Port of Hamburg / Rotterdam → Austrian Terminals): Preferred for ultra-large container vessels (ULCV) and heavy transatlantic ocean cargo. Goods move seamlessly via green rail corridors (AlbatrosExpress) under bonded transit directly into Upper Austrian bonded warehouses.

A. Carbon Border Adjustment Mechanism (CBAM) Compliance
The EU’s CBAM regulation requires importers of carbon-intensive goods—such as steel, aluminum, cement, and fertilizers—to report embedded emissions. Storing CBAM-affected industrial components within an Austrian bonded warehouse provides manufacturers with a strategic window to audit, verify, and document carbon intensity data prior to formal customs declaration, eliminating compliance penalties.

C. Nearshoring & Dual-Sourcing Central European Storage
Geopolitical friction and global shipping disruptions have pushed European manufacturers from Pure Just-In-Time (JIT) models toward "Just-In-Case" (JIC) regional buffering. Austrian bonded warehouses serve as ideal Central European redistribution hubs (CEE hubs), allowing international suppliers to hold 60 to 90 days of safety buffer stock near EU buyers without incurring immediate tax liabilities.
